Most dental offices (if not all) are equipped with digital X-rays, which emit up to 90% less radiation than traditional film x-rays. Four bitewing x-rays (taken at a routine dental exam) expose you to .005 mSv of radiation, which is less than one day of natural background radiation. On average, Americans are exposed to about 3 mSv of natural background radiation per year. This background radiation varies according to where you live. People living at higher altitudes (like Colorado) will receive about 1.5 mSv more background radiation than people living at sea level.
Dental x-rays are considered much safer than medical x-rays, because very little radiation is emitted and the radiation is directed towards area of the body that is not as radiosensitive. Just to put things in perspective, a person receiving a CT scan of their chest will be exposed to about 7 mSv of radiation. Four bitewing x-rays emit 1400x less radiation than a CT scan of the chest.
A panoramic x-ray you see in the photo behind me, will expose you to about .007 mSv of radiation. One transatlantic flight equals to about the same amount of radiation as 7 digital panoramic x-rays.
